The PR6424/119-121 sensor is a 16 mm eddy current proximity probe used in industrial machinery monitoring systems. It is designed for non-contact measurement of shaft displacement and is typically used in conjunction with signal converters for vibration monitoring and condition analysis.
It is widely applied in power generation and industrial rotating equipment systems.

Applications
The Epro PR6424/119-121 eddy current sensor is used for non-contact measurement of shaft displacement and vibration in rotating machinery. It is commonly integrated into industrial condition monitoring systems for continuous mechanical monitoring.
Typical applications include:
Steam turbine vibration monitoring systems
Gas turbine condition monitoring systems
Compressor radial and axial displacement measurement
Pump vibration monitoring systems
Generator shaft position monitoring
Industrial rotating machinery diagnostics
